Clear filters

Opinion

Top 20: A Solid 2016/17

20th September 2017

Catalyst / top 20

Opinion

Catalyst’s 2013 Industry Analysis #1

6th August 2013

Biffa / big 5 / FCC / Industry / Sita / top 20 / turnover / Veolia / Viridor

Send this to a friend